Heat pumps save more on operat-
ing costs during the heating cycle
than heat/cool models. The table
below shows that the higher initial
cost of purchasing a heat pump is
quickly made up in lower operating
costs.
Use the map to identify the climate
zone’s designated number. Reading
down the left-hand column of the
table, select the cost/kWh rate in
this zone that most closely approxi-
mates your local rate. The approxi-
mated savings and payback period
is found at the intersection of your
zone/rate line and the desired Btuh
Cooling Capacity column. Exact
savings are determined by lifestyle,
local electrical rates, and climatic
conditions.
